ZTNA Tags are not synchronized with Fortigate

  • December 28, 2022
  • 4 replies
  • 7842 views

Hello,

 

we are facing with a problem with synchronization ZTNA Tags between EMS and Fortigate.

Tags created on EMS are apply on clients, EMS is resolving hosts and IPs appropriately but new tags are not visible on Fortigate. Also if client has changed IP address (in tag there is rule searching users in AD groups) he's not being resolved appropriately.

 

In my example there is a problem with tag "secure_devops" (tag not visible on FG) and "secure_admins" (user has changed IP address and he's not availble under this tag).

 

FortiGate 600E v. 7.2.3 b. 1262

EMS v. 7.0.7 b. 0398

 

How can i fix this bug/problem?

Hi @ArtSyk 

 

Please execute the following commands in FortiGate CLI to force sync (restart) the ZTNA tags between FortiGate and Forticlient EMS.

 

diagnose test application fcnacd 99

 

Before that, run the following command to see the log in real-time and identify the issue. You can also share the logs with us.

 

diagnose debug application fcnacd -1 
diagnose endpoint filter show-large-data yes
diagnose debug enable
